‘Walking the Floor Over You’: The Honky-Tonk Song That Shaped Country Music History

Country music has undergone many transformations over the years, evolving from folk-rock styles in the 1970s to the neo-traditional sounds that dominate today. Despite these changes, some songs have remained influential, shaping the genre’s direction and inspiring countless artists. One such song is Ernest Tubb’s “Walking the Floor Over You,” a track that played a pivotal role in country music’s development and continues to be celebrated decades after its release.

Ernest Tubb is recognized as one of the founding figures of American country music. His career began in the late 1930s, and he gained widespread attention during World War II with his patriotic and traditional country tunes. Released in 1941, “Walking the Floor Over You” marked a turning point not only for Tubb but for the entire country music scene. Originally recorded with just Tubb’s voice and an acoustic guitar, it was later re-released featuring his band, the Texas Troubadours, which helped it reach a broader audience.

The song quickly became a hit, climbing to number 23 on the charts at a time when country music was still finding its place in mainstream America. Its success proved that listeners were ready for a fresh style of songwriting that combined heartfelt lyrics with honky-tonk instrumentation. Over time, “Walking the Floor Over You” sold over a million copies—a remarkable feat for any song, especially one from the early 1940s.

Throughout his career, Tubb revisited this iconic song multiple times, recording new versions that introduced different musical elements and vocal styles. One notable rendition came in 1979 when he collaborated with Merle Haggard and Charlie Daniels. This version reached number 31 on the Billboard Hot Country Singles chart, demonstrating the song’s lasting appeal across generations.

Today, “Walking the Floor Over You” is often cited as one of the first true honky-tonk songs. Its pioneering use of electric guitar helped shape country music’s sound and influenced many artists who followed. Rolling Stone magazine included it on their list of the 200 Greatest Country Songs of All Time in 2024, underscoring its importance in music history.

The song’s legacy goes beyond just its musical innovation; it also reflects the authenticity and relatability that Ernest Tubb brought to country music. His honest voice and simple storytelling connected with audiences who saw him as a genuine figure facing life’s ups and downs. This connection helped solidify his place as a country music legend.

As country music continues to evolve, songs like “Walking the Floor Over You” remain touchstones for understanding where the genre began and how it grew. It stands as a reminder of country music’s deep roots and enduring power to tell stories about everyday life through melody and rhythm.
